Oct 02, 2009 – New EU PMP ruling… Could an American Version be On Its Way?
Thanks to a new European Union ruling, any Personal Music Player (PMP) sold in Europe will need to have a lower default volume level to avoid ear damage. These “safe exposure” levels will be on all new MP3 players, including Apple’s iPod, although users will be able to override the settings if they choose. The ruling also calls for more conspicuous information on the dangers of hearing loss caused by loud earphones to be included on PMP packaging. According to research from the EU, listening to high-level music for one hour per day for five years could lead to permanent hearing loss, and thanks to the popularity of the iPod this decade, things could get really bad for the ears of people worldwide.
